How much do structural steel project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for structural steel project manager in the United States is $102,682.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$78,500.00 and $123,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Fabrication & Assembly: Make It Right

  • Identify the piece mark, drawing revision and finish codes.
  • Determine what parts are needed, their quantities, shapes and grades.
  • Understand part orientation, weld symbols and industry acronyms.
  • Identify the order of operations in order to fabricate the assembly.
  • Read and interpret structural steel shop drawings and weld symbols.
  • Perform accurate measurements, layout, and marking using tapes, squares, levels, and layout tools.
  • Perform tack welding.
  • Perform thermal cutting (oxy-fuel and/or plasma) and grinding as required.

Safety & Teamwork: Safety > Speed

  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work area.
  • Safely operate overhead cranes, welders, torches and grinders.
  • Work collaboratively with CNC operators, foremen, welders, fabricators, painters and QC personnel.

Quality & Documentation: Continuous Improvement

  • Fabricate work in accordance with AISC Quality Management System requirements.
  • Verify material heat numbers, piece marks, and orientation.
  • Perform self-inspection of work and correct issues before QC inspection.
  • Communicate discrepancies in drawings or materials to supervision.
